// Plotfile structure:
// 1. Lines that begin with # are comments
// 2. ASCII file format
// 3. Header lines begin with <tags> and end with </tags>
// 4. Valid headers
//      <plotfile ncolumns nrecords>    (signifies beginning of plotfile)
//      <description> (beginning of description lines)
//      <ezset>       (signifies beginning of ezset commands)
//      <columns>     Beginning of data columns
// 5. Data is ASCII file format, one record per line
//    Number of columns is variable and is set by ncolumns header
